The default background color for GRUB2 in ubuntu11.10 is a dark-magenta-purple. How to change this color to black so that I don't have a purple splash on boot. (I want to keep everything black and hidden).
The background color is already set to black:
gksudo gedit /etc/grub.d/05_debian_theme
COLOR_NORMAL="white/black"
This is called the 'normal background' color in GRUB. The word 'black' in this position means 'transparent' to GRUB2
